How to Install a Bathtub Yourself
Mounting a bath tub isn't precisely brain surgery, but it does require strong plumbing, woodworking, as well as often, tiling skills. Replacing an old bath tub with a new one is also a reasonably tough job. If the old tub is conveniently obtainable, the task can move quickly; if you need to open up a wall to remove the old tub and place the brand-new tub, the task is a lot harder. In either situation, the job is within a home handyman's abilities, although you will certainly need a helper to vacate the old tub and also set in the new one. See to it you have actually qualified on your own for the job and also are comfortable attempting it. As opposed to working with a specialist to take over a halfway-completed job, it is better to take into consideration utilizing one prior to you begin. Chances are you might need a specialist plumber to make tube connections.
This article will certainly help you mount a brand-new bath tub in your shower room if you have actually already bought a brand-new tub and also don't require to alter the arrangement of your previous water system pipes.

  • Planning for the Installation


    First of all, the sustaining framework provided with the bath needs to be fitted (if needed) according to the supplier's guidelines. Next, fit the faucets or mixer to the bath tub. When fitting the faucet block, it is very important to make sure that if the tap features a plastic washer, it is fitted in between the bath as well as the faucets. On a plastic bath, it is likewise sensible to fit a supporting plate under the faucets unit to avoid strain on the tub.
    Fit the adaptable faucet connectors to the bottom of the two faucets making use of 2 nuts and also olives (often provided with the tub). Fit the plug-hole electrical outlet by smearing mastic filler round the sink outlet opening, and after that pass the electrical outlet through the hole in the bathroom. Use the nut provided by the supplier to fit the plug-hole. Analyze the plug-hole electrical outlet for an inlet on the side for the overflow pipe.
    Next off, fit the end of the versatile overflow pipeline to the overflow outlet. Afterwards, screw the pipeline to the overflow face which ought to be fitted inside the bathroom. Make sure you utilize every one of the supplied washing machines.
    Attach the trap to the bottom of the waste electrical outlet on the bath tub by winding the thread of the waste electrical outlet with silicone mastic or PTFE tape, and also screw on the trap to the electrical outlet. Attach the bottom of the overflow tube in a comparable manner.The bathroom should now prepare to be fitted in its final setting.

    Removing Old Touches


    If you need to replace old taps with new ones as a part of your installation, then the first thing you ought to do is detach the water. After doing so, switch on the faucets to drain any water staying in the system. The procedure of getting rid of the existing taps can be quite troublesome as a result of the restricted accessibility that is often the situation.
    Utilize a container wrench (crowsfoot spanner) or a faucet tool to undo the nut that links the supply pipelines to the faucets. Have a towel ready for the remaining water that will certainly come from the pipes. When the supply pipes have actually been gotten rid of, make use of the same tool to loosen the nut that holds the taps onto the bath/basin. You will need to quit the single taps from turning during this process. When the faucets have actually been gotten rid of, the holes in the bath/basin will certainly need to be cleaned of any old sealing compound.
    Prior to going on to fit the brand-new faucets, contrast the pipeline links on the old faucets to the brand-new faucets. If the old taps are longer than the new taps, then a shank adapter is required for the new taps to fit.

    Installing the Bathtub


    Using the two wooden boards under its feet, place the bathtub in the required position. The wooden boards are useful in evenly spreading out the weight of the tub over the area of the boards rather than focusing all the weight onto four small points.
    The next goal is to make certain that the bath tub is leveled all round. This can be attained by examining the level as well as changing the feet on the tub up until the spirit level reads degree.
    To mount faucets, fit all-time low of the furthest flexible tap connector to the ideal supply pipeline by making a compression sign up with; then do the exact same for the other faucet.
    Activate the water system as well as inspect all joints and also brand-new pipework for leaks and tighten them if necessary. Load the bath tub and also check the overflow electrical outlet as well as the typical outlet for leakages.
    Ultimately, take care of the bath paneling as described in the supplier's user's manual. Tiling as well as sealing around the bath tub must wait until the bath tub has actually been utilized at the very least once as this will resolve it into its final placement.

    Fitting New Taps


    If the tails of the brand-new taps are plastic, then you will certainly need a plastic connector to stop damage to the string. One end of the port fits on the plastic tail of the tap and also the various other end gives a link to the existent supply pipelines.
    If you need to fit a monobloc, after that you will certainly require lowering couplers, which links the 10mm pipe of the monobloc to the common 15mm supply pipe.
    Next off, place the tap in the placing hole in the bath/basin making certain that the washers are in location between the faucet and the sink. Protect the faucet in place with the maker offered backnut. As soon as the tap is firmly in place, the supply pipes can be attached to the tails of the taps. The faucets can either be linked by using corrugated copper piping or with typical faucet ports. The previous type needs to be connected to the faucet ends first, tightening up only by hand. The supply pipelines can later be linked to the other end. Tighten both ends with a spanner after both ends have actually been connected.

    Tiling Around the Tub


    In the area where the bath fulfills the tile, it is essential to seal the accompanies a silicone rubber caulking. This is important as the fitting can relocate enough to break an inflexible seal, creating the water to permeate the wall surface between the bathroom and also the tiling, resulting in issues with wetness and possible leakages to the ceiling listed below.
    You can choose from a range of coloured sealers to assimilate your fixtures and also installations. They are sold in tubes as well as cartridges, and are capable of securing voids up to a width of 3mm (1/8 inch). If you have a bigger void to fill, you can fill it with spins of soaked paper or soft rope. Bear in mind to always fill the tub with water prior to securing, to allow for the motion experienced when the bathtub remains in usage. The sealant can break relatively very early if you do not take into account this movement before sealing.
    Alternatively, ceramic coving or quadrant tiles can be utilized to border the bathroom or shower tray. Plastic strips of coving, which are easy to use and also cut to size, are likewise quickly readily available on the marketplace. It is advisable to fit the tiles using water-resistant or water resistant sticky as well as cement.

    How to Install a Freestanding Bathtub?


    Installing a freestanding bathtub or any kind of bathtub is not a difficult task if you have a sophisticated guide on installing a freestanding bathtub in your bathroom. Aside from getting the freestanding bathtub to your bathroom, you can do all the work without paying a plumber. A bathroom with a bathtub is a retreat where you can feel the sensation of coming home and soaking in that hot water. It is a great way to remove all the stress from your day.



    This guide will walk you through installing a freestanding bathtub in simple steps and help you find relief.


    Slope


    Make sure your bathroom has a proper slope. If your floor lacks a slope, the water flow to the drain will not function, which leads to a blocked drain which can cost you money. You can use the level device to see your bathroom's vertical and horizontal aspects. Once you have that information, you must carry out the next step.


    Placement


    A freestanding bathtub has a unique characteristic that helps you bring elegance to your bathroom. A freestanding bathtub comes in various sizes and shapes suitable for different types of bathrooms.



    According to the information you gathered from the level device, you must pick a bathtub that suits your style and fits your bathroom aesthetically. You can place a freestanding bathtub virtually anywhere, such as in the corner, near the wall, or even at the center of your bathroom. However, you must ensure proper plumbing where you want to install the tub. If not, then you must call a plumber.


    Clean the bathroom floor


    After deciding where to place the bathtub, you must clean the entire bathroom floor so that the dust and debris do not accumulate underneath the tub. Simple cleaning is enough, and you will clean it again after the installation.


    Steps to Install a Freestanding Bathtub:


    STEP 1: Place the protective blanket in the adjacent area where you want to install the bathtub. It will help you protect the bathtub's sides when you do the installation.



    STEP 2: Now, place the 4x4 lumber in the area where you want to install the bathtub. Place the bathtub on top of the lumber, and align the drain line with the bathtub drain.



    STEP 3: A freestanding bathtub comes with a drain kit. If not, make sure you purchase one with your bathtub. You can pop that drain kit and align it with your bathroom drain line. Ensure that you tighten the drain nut enough so there is no water leakage. You must also clean the bathtub’s drain to remove the factory dirt and debris.



    STEP 4: Clean the drain hole in your bathroom. It helps to do the installation without any water blockage. A drain cleaner or bleach will suffice. Once the drain dries entirely, take a small amount of clear silicon and place it around the underside of the pipe flange.



    STEP 5: Attach the drain tailpiece to the bottom of the bathtub. Place the rubber or plastic bushing with the plumbing material at the top of the tailpiece and screw the drain nut up the tube until it tightens both the bathtub’s drain and the drain tailpiece. Now you must add the lubricant to the seal to ensure there is no water leakage in the pipe connection.



    STEP 6: Place caulk around the bottom edge of the bathtub. Take out the lumbar support and carefully bring the bathtub to the floor. Use a damp cloth to clean the excess caulk and debris and plumber putty to cover the tub drains and the floor.


    Tips to Maintain a Freestanding Bathtub:


  • Always look for the clog in the drain. You can pull it out with a small stick if hair or debris is in the gutter.


  • Use mild cleaning components, which will help you preserve the bathtub for a long time and will also help you remove surface-level scratches.


  • Do not use strong solutions such as concentrated bleach to remove stains. Instead, mix water and diluted bleach with a ratio of 10:2, respectively. Apply it to the tub's surface and leave it for 15-20 minutes to remove any surface-level stains.


  • Always check the floor drain. You may unclog it using any small sticks or a small vacuum to suck out all the debris.


  • Check the heater or faucet immediately if you smell rust or grease in the water. Rust in the water may stain or damage the bathtub in the long run.


  • If you want to sand the bathtub, try using 400 grit sandpaper or 600 grit sandpaper for a more refined finish.
